What is the AMBA bus protocol?

What is the AMBA bus protocol?

The Advanced Micro controller Bus Architecture ( AMBA) bus protocols is a set of interconnect specifications from ARM that standardizes on chip communication mechanisms between various functional blocks (or IP) for building high performance SOC designs.

Can Amba-AHB protocol be used in all applications?

This AMBA-AHB protocol can be adopted in all the applications provided the design should be an AHB compliant. Keywords AHB busmatrix, Arbiter, System on Chip, FSM for master and slave, Master and slave side arbitration, IP, VHDL. A Novel Bus Encoding Scheme from Energy and Crosstalk Efficiency Perspective for AMBA Based Generic SoC Systems.

What is Amba AHB?

AHB is part of the AMBA convention family. The AMBA AHB is designed f or high-performance, high-clock s ystem modules. ”The“ AHB acts as the syste m’s high-performance backbone bus. AHB supports t he interfaces. All signal transitions relate only to the rising clock design flow. This paper describes AM BA AHB design and

What is APB (advanced high-performance bus) protocol?

The latest spec (APB 2.0) is available on ARM website here and is a relatively easy protocol to learn. AHB: The Advanced High-performance Bus (AHB) is used for connecting components that need higher bandwidth on a shared bus.

What is the difference between APB and AHB?

1 APB : The Advanced Peripheral Bus (APB) is used for connecting low bandwidth peripherals. 2 AHB: The Advanced High-performance Bus (AHB) is used for connecting components that need higher bandwidth on a shared bus. 3 AHB-lite protocol is a simplified version of AHB.

What is AHB-Lite protocol?

Similar to APB, this is a shared bus protocol for multiple masters and slaves, but higher bandwidth is possible through burst data transfers. The latest spec can be found on ARM website here and is relatively easy to learn AHB-lite protocol is a simplified version of AHB.